RED RIVER TECHNOLOGY LLC Government Contract #12639525F0911

RED RIVER TECHNOLOGY LLC was awarded a contract with the United States Government for $852,220.14. The contract was awarded by the agency office MRPBS MINNEAPOLIS MN, which is a division with the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service within the Department of Agriculture.

Summary of Award

The recipient of the federal contract is RED RIVER TECHNOLOGY LLC, a U.S.-Owned Business based in New Hampshire. The contract, funded by the Department of Agriculture's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service, is for a VAST STORAGE SOLUTION in support of NVSL BIG DATA SERVICES PROGRAM, with a total value of $333,114.54.
